Cloud-Connected Critical Care Monitoring Devices Market Segmentation and Market Companies
Segments
- Based on type, the global cloud-connected critical care monitoring devices market can be segmented into vital signs monitors, fetal monitors, and multi-parameter monitors. Vital signs monitors are crucial in monitoring key physiological parameters such as blood pressure, heart rate, respiratory rate, and temperature. Fetal monitors are used during pregnancy and labor to track the baby's heart rate and contractions. Multi-parameter monitors provide comprehensive monitoring by measuring various vital signs simultaneously, offering a more holistic view of the patient's condition.
- In terms of device type, the market can be categorized into portable monitoring devices and standalone monitoring devices. Portable monitoring devices offer the flexibility of monitoring patients on the go and are especially useful in ambulatory settings. Standalone monitoring devices, on the other hand, are designed for stationary use in hospitals, clinics, and other healthcare facilities.
- By end-user, the market can be divided into hospitals, ambulatory surgical centers, specialty clinics, and home care settings. Hospitals account for a significant share of the market due to the high volume of critical care patients they handle on a daily basis. Ambulatory surgical centers are witnessing increasing adoption of cloud-connected critical care monitoring devices to enhance patient safety during procedures. Specialty clinics and home care settings are also emerging as key end-users of these devices.
Market Players
- Some of the leading players in the global cloud-connected critical care monitoring devices market include Koninklijke Philips N.V., GE Healthcare, Medtronic, Baxter, Siemens Healthineers, Smiths Medical, Johnson & Johnson, Masimo, Edwards Lifesciences Corporation, and Nihon Kohden Corporation. These companies are actively involved in product development, strategic collaborations, and mergers and acquisitions to strengthen their market presence and expand their product portfolios.
- Emerging players such as Mindray, Infinium Medical, Compumedics Limited, and Penlon Limited are also making significant contributions to the market by introducing innovative technologies and solutions. The competitive landscape of the market is characterized by intense competition, with companies focusing on developing advanced monitoring devices that offer real-time data transmission, remote monitoring capabilities, and seamless integration with electronic health records.
The global cloud-connected critical care monitoring devices market is experiencing significant growth driven by the increasing prevalence of chronic diseases, the rising geriatric population, and the growing demand for remote patient monitoring solutions. With the advancements in healthcare technology and the shift towards value-based care, there is a growing emphasis on improving patient outcomes and reducing healthcare costs, driving the adoption of cloud-connected critical care monitoring devices. These devices offer healthcare providers real-time access to patient data, enabling proactive interventions, early detection of deteriorating conditions, and improved decision-making.
One of the key trends shaping the market is the integration of artificial intelligence (AI) and machine learning algorithms into monitoring devices to enhance predictive analytics and personalized patient care. AI-powered monitoring devices can analyze vast amounts of patient data to identify patterns, trends, and anomalies, enabling healthcare providers to deliver more targeted and efficient care. This trend is expected to gain traction in the coming years as healthcare organizations look for advanced solutions to manage patient populations effectively and improve clinical outcomes.
Another important aspect of the market is the growing adoption of telemedicine and telehealth solutions, which are driving the demand for cloud-connected monitoring devices that facilitate remote patient monitoring and virtual consultations. Telemedicine allows healthcare providers to monitor patients from a distance, reducing the need for in-person visits and increasing patient access to care. Cloud-connected critical care monitoring devices play a crucial role in enabling telemedicine services by ensuring seamless data transmission, secure storage, and easy accessibility of patient information for remote healthcare teams.
Moreover, the COVID-19 pandemic has further accelerated the adoption of cloud-connected critical care monitoring devices as healthcare systems worldwide faced unprecedented challenges in managing patient influx and ensuring continuity of care. The pandemic highlighted the importance of remote monitoring technologies in supporting healthcare delivery, especially for patients with chronic conditions or those requiring intensive care. As the healthcare industry embraces digital transformation and telehealth becomes a standard practice, the demand for cloud-connected critical care monitoring devices is expected to continue to rise.
